The post holder will be responsible for the provision of a comprehensive and efficient Reception/Health Records Service to patients/service users within the East Lancashire Health Community, ensuring a high level of Customer Care whilst maintaining confidentiality at all times.

**General Duties will include the following**:
- Prepare clinic case notes with specific attention to the data items required for commissioning purposes and data quality in line with the Trust’s Clinical Records Policy, ensuring that all appointment details are entered onto the Patient Administration System (PAS)
- Arrange when necessary the attendance of interpreter/link workers for patients who require communication assistance when attending clinics.
- Booking in patients attending outpatient clinics and issuing return appointments as directed by the consultant/nursing staff prior to the patient leaving the Department.
- Request and ensure delivery of health records for patients either attending a clinic or an admission, from all departments within this Trust and other hospitals.
- Prioritise own workload ensuring agreed timescales are met each day involving the provision of case notes.
- Adhere to departmental policies and procedures and participate in audits in order to maintain data quality and provide an efficient service
- Maintain the confidentiality of any information obtained regarding patients and be aware of Data Protection and Freedom of Information policy
- Work within the departmental shift patterns to cover the opening hours of the service, i.e. 8.00am - 8.00pm as and when required, including Bank Holidays
- Act as first point of contact for all patients and visitors to the Department, providing a comprehensive reception and clerical Service to patients, relatives, carers, consultants and their teams
